Operation Devil Hunt (Bengali: অপারেশন ডেভিল হান্ট) was an operation launched by the Interim government of Bangladesh on 8 February 2025 following protests over a violent attack on students and civilians in Gazipur by Awami League supporters on 7 February 2025. The operation targets alleged henchmen and supporters of the deposed prime minister Sheikh Hasina.
